AFIH Course
The AFIH Course equips professionals with essential skills for managing occupational health in metal fabrication, covering hazard identification, exposure control, medical surveillance, and performance improvement strategies to ensure workplace safety and compliance.

What will I learn?
The AFIH Course provides a focused, practical toolkit to identify key hazards in metal fabrication, plan exposure assessments, and apply the hierarchy of controls effectively. Learn to design medical surveillance programmes, manage health data securely, meet legal and standards requirements, and use incident trend analysis, KPIs, and clear communication strategies to drive measurable, continuous improvement on the shop floor.

Develop skills
- Hazard profiling: map and prioritise metal fabrication health risks quickly.
- Exposure assessment: plan noise, fume, and solvent monitoring to OSHA standards.
- Control design: apply hierarchy of controls to reduce welding and solvent risks.
- Medical surveillance: set exams, biomonitoring, and fitness-for-work rules.
- Incident analytics: use KPIs and root cause tools to drive safer operations.
